php - 输入时提交

标签 php javascript html

我有这样的东西:

        <div style="float:left;"><a class="btn btn-primary" href="#sign-in" data-toggle="modal"  data-dismiss="modal" ><i class="icon-ok icon-white"></i> Sign-in</a></div>
        <div>
            <a href="#" class="btn btn-small" data-dismiss="modal"><i class="icon-remove"></i> Close</a>
            <button class="btn-success btn-small" type="button" name="submit" value="login" onclick="forgotPassAjax();"><i class="icon-ok icon-white"></i> Send</button>
        </div>

在我需要它在输入时可单击,现在您必须手动使用光标单击按钮,我该如何实现这一点?我之前看过一些JS例子,有没有更简单的方法?现在它有一个 onclick 函数,该函数是出于某种目的在 php 中生成的,那么我应该做什么?

最佳答案

jQuery:

$(document).on("keydown", processKeyEvents);
$(document).on("keypress", processKeyEvents);

function processKeyEvents(event) {
     if ( event.which == 13 ) {
        forgotPassAjax();
     }
}

您可以将 $(document) 替换为 $("焦点元素的 id") 以限制按键的范围。

关于php - 输入时提交,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13937025/

相关文章:

javascript - 如何在Ajax中调用curl命令

php - mysql组之间的用户注册计数

javascript - 在指令的链接函数中修改事件中的范围变量

javascript - 使用 jQuery 查找子字符串

javascript - 如何在谷歌搜索中制作菜单公司简介网站?如何编辑sitemap.xml 来设置它?

php - 为什么 Symfony 3 单元测试从实际的包中移出?

javascript - 如何从 localhost url 读取图像并在 javascript 中获取其宽度和高度

javascript - 清除表单上的按钮设置

html - 右对齐单元格表格中的文本,但向右添加 'variable' 填充以从表格边框创建空间

javascript - 当我滚动那个 div 时,如何在 jQuery var 中存储特定的 div id